Well, how can anyone truly attest to the interests of the community at large without polls or statistics or attendance records from the last time the Rams were in L.A. regardless of where they live? Even a Rams fan living in the city isn't really going to be able to tell you how many of the x million people living there would turn out for games on a regular basis.
Ask and ye shall receive....

Per game attendance for the final 5 years in LA:
1990 - 59,920
1991 - 51,586
1992 - 51,813
1993 - 45,401
1994 - 42,312

Per game attendance for the most recent 5 years in St.L:
2003 - 66,057
2004 - 65,923
2005 - 65,460
2006 - 65,326
2007 - 63,044


Well yea, HUb, but you gotta go back farther than that!

Ok, fine. Over their entire time in St. Louis, the Rams have averaged 63,886 per game. During that same time period in LA, the Rams averaged 52,873 per game.

Well yea, HUb, but look at last year.....that was the worst attendance the Rams have ever seen!

Really? The 2007 Rams averaged 63,044 per game. That single season is better than any season in nearly the final two decades of LA Rams football.
